
Dwyer Instruments 2302 Pressure Gage
The Dwyer Instruments 2302 Magnehelic Differential Pressure Gage is a staple in the HVACR industry for monitoring low-pressure air or non-combustible gases. Featuring a 1-0-1" w.c. zero center range, this gage is specifically designed for applications requiring precise measurement of both positive and negative differential pressures. Built with a frictionless Magnehelic movement, it provides high sensitivity without the risk of fluid evaporation or freezing, ensuring reliable performance in harsh field conditions. The 4" diameter dial face offers clear visibility, while the 1/8" female NPT process connections allow for seamless integration into standard pneumatic lines. Whether you are performing flange or flush mounting in a control panel or a fan system, this gage delivers the accuracy needed for filter monitoring, duct static pressure measurement, and fan pressure detection. Its rugged die-cast aluminum housing is built to withstand mechanical vibration and overpressure, making it a dependable choice for technical balancing and system diagnostics.

Can the Dwyer 2302 be used with liquid media?
No, this gage is strictly designed for use with air and non-combustible gases. Using liquids will damage the internal diaphragm and 1/8" NPT ports.
What is the accuracy rating for this specific Magnehelic gage?
This differential pressure gage typically maintains an accuracy of +/- 2% of the full scale throughout its range, provided it is calibrated and mounted in the vertical position.
Is the zero-point adjustable if the needle shifts?
Yes, there is an external zero-adjust screw located on the bottom of the cover, allowing for easy recalibration without disassembly.
